When it comes to wrapping brisket during the smoking process, many seasoned pitmasters aim to wrap at an internal temperature between 155°F and 165°F. This range represents the “stall” phase, where the meat’s internal temperature plateaus due to evaporative cooling. Wrapping the brisket at this point-often called the Texas Crutch-helps retain moisture and pushes the cooking forward while preserving tenderness without sacrificing bark development.
The decision to wrap within this temperature window largely depends on your preferred balance of tenderness, bark texture, and flavor intensity. Some pitmasters prefer wrapping earlier to minimize cooking time and enhance juiciness, while others wait until closer to 165°F or even later to maintain a firmer bark and more pronounced smoky flavor.
Vital signs for wrapping include the appearance and feel of the bark-when it turns dry but not too crusty-and the internal temperature approaching the stall. If you wrap too early, you risk steaming the bark and losing that coveted crust integrity; wrap too late, and the meat could dry out during the final stage.
The choice of wrapping material-pink butcher paper versus foil-also impacts moisture retention. Butcher paper is more breathable, allowing the brisket to “breathe,” which preserves bark texture while maintaining juiciness. Foil seals in moisture but tends to soften the bark, resulting in a more tender but less textured outer layer.
Temperature stability and smoke consistency during the entire cook profoundly influence flavor complexity. Fluctuations might cause uneven smoke absorption or longer cook times, affecting tenderness.
Ultimately, preferences vary widely in the BBQ community, with some purists opting for no wrap at all to maximize bark, and others swearing by the wrapper’s benefits for a tender, luscious brisket. Experimentation aligned with your taste goals is key.

When deciding whether to let your faucets drip during cold weather, the key factor to monitor is the temperature. Generally, when outdoor temperatures dip to around 20°F (-6°C) or lower, the risk of freezing pipes increases significantly, especially if the cold snap lasts for several hours or days. The frequency and duration of these cold spells are crucial-short, mild drops might not require intervention, but prolonged freezes elevate the risk and make dripping faucets a smart precaution.
Your plumbing system’s age and condition also play a critical role. Older pipes or those in uninsulated or drafty areas of your home are more vulnerable to freezing. In contrast, newer or well-insulated systems might not need as frequent precautions, unless the cold is extreme. It’s wise to assess vulnerable spots like exterior walls, basements, crawl spaces, or attics, where pipes are more exposed to the elements.
Regarding how long to keep faucets dripping, it’s best to maintain a slow, steady trickle during the cold period, especially overnight when temperatures often hit their lowest. However, water conservation should also be considered. Use only the minimum flow necessary to keep water moving-no more than a small stream-to reduce waste while effectively preventing freezing.
Telltale signs prompting urgent action include visible frost on pipes, sluggish water flow, or unusual sounds such as banging or gurgling-indications that freezing is imminent or underway. To maximize effectiveness and safety, open cabinet doors to allow warmer air to circulate around pipes, keep the thermostat consistent, and seal cracks that allow cold air drafts. By balancing these steps and being mindful of your local climate and plumbing conditions, you can protect your pipes efficiently and responsibly.
